Think Yoga’s just about stretching? Think again. Whether you’re a runner, lifter, or weekend warrior, adding Yoga to your routine can give you a serious edge. Here’s how it helps you perform better and recover faster. 

 

1. Core Strength  

So much of your power—whether it’s sprinting, swinging, or lifting—comes from your core. Yoga poses like plank and boat fire up deep stabilizing muscles, giving you better balance and strength for your sport. 

 

2. Better Breathing Techniques  

Breath is fuel. Yoga teaches you to control your breathing, which can help you push through tough workouts, enhance your muscle-mind connection, and recover quicker. Deep, steady breaths give your muscles more oxygen. 

 

3. Mind-to-Muscle Connection  

Yoga slows you down and helps you tune in to how your body moves. That awareness carries over into your workouts—better form, more focus, and fewer injuries. 

 

4. Flexibility & Range of Motion  

Tight hips? Stiff shoulders? Yoga opens things up. Increased mobility means smoother movement, less soreness, and a body that bounces back quicker.
